Treatment of Cancer With Immune Checkpoint Inhibition Therapy Boosted by High Intensity Focused Ultrasound Histotripsy

Condition: Cancer · Metastatic Cancer  ·  Sponsor: UMC Utrecht

PhasePhase 1
Planned participants24
Who can joinAll sexes, 18 Years to no upper limit
Healthy volunteersNo

About this study

This phase 1 clinical trial aims to evaluate the safety, tolerability and feasibility of combination treatment of High Intensity Focused Ultrasound Histotripsy (HIFU-HT) and immune checkpoint inhibitors (ICI) in adult patients with metastatic or unresectable cancer that have progressive disease after regular treatment. Patients will undergo one single session of HIFU-HT during treatment with ipilimumab and nivolumab. Safety, tolerability and feasibility endpoints will be studied as well as radiologic, immunologic and clinical response.
